At a glance

Bari Brahmana, on the highway south of the city, is Jammu’s main industrial estate, with steel, pharma, food and consumer goods units. Gangyal and Digiana, closer in, have smaller manufacturers and workshops.

In the old city, Raghunath Bazaar sells dry fruits, clothes and gifts to locals and pilgrims. R.S. Pura, towards the border, grows and mills basmati rice.

Around Jammu

The areas, estates and markets that matter in Jammu.

Bari Brahmana industrial estate

Steel, pharma, food and consumer goods units supplying the valley and the plains. Production, dispatch and dealer ledgers are kept in Tally and Excel.

Gangyal and Digiana industrial areas

Smaller manufacturers, workshops and warehouses. Job cards and stock registers are mostly on paper.

Raghunath Bazaar

Dry fruit, clothing and gift shops serving locals and pilgrims. Counter billing and supplier credit from Amritsar and Delhi are the daily records.

R.S. Pura

Basmati farming and rice mills near the border. Paddy purchases, milling yield and bag stock are tracked by hand.

The Katra road

Hotels, taxi operators and transporters serving Vaishno Devi pilgrims. Room and vehicle bookings peak around Navratri and the summer.

How software gets chosen

How Jammu businesses pick and use software.

Jammu manufacturers often came from Punjab or Delhi business families and run plants the same way: Tally for accounts, a trusted manager for the floor. They buy software when a large buyer or a subsidy claim needs cleaner records.

Dry fruit and retail traders in Raghunath Bazaar buy slowly and on a neighbour’s word. A billing and stock tool that runs on the shop computer without the internet is their starting point.

Where it breaks

Where Jammu businesses lose time and money.

Stock for the valley must be ready before the road closes

Distributors in Jammu supply Srinagar and beyond. Without a view of what each dealer sold last winter, they stock by guess.

Dry fruit prices change and our margins vanish

Walnuts, almonds and dates are bought at different rates through the year. Without lot costing, some sales lose money unseen.

Navratri bookings spill out of the register

Katra hotels and taxi operators take bookings by phone and WhatsApp. Peak weeks bring double bookings and missed pick-ups.
